Sam Lantinga
b740fb4389 Fixed bug 944
Tatu Kilappa      2010-02-11 12:13:20 PST

When compiling with -Wconversion, gcc complains about a cast in SDL_endian.h
that might change the result as we are casting from an int into an Uint16. This
is of course not visible unless we are on a non-x86 platform where the
assembler is not available.

While it's not really an error, the warning is really annoying. To fix, change
SDL_endian.h line 87 to:

  return(Uint16)((x<<8)|(x>>8));

Thank you.

Sam Lantinga
b0847f3de2 General improvements for user custom event registration
* Switched event type to enum (int32)
* Switched polling by mask to polling by type range
* Added SDL_RegisterEvents() to allow dynamic user event registration
* Spread events out to allow inserting new related events without breaking binary compatibility
* Added padding to event structures so they're the same size regardless of 32-bit compiler structure packing settings
* Split SDL_HasEvent() to SDL_HasEvent() for a single event and SDL_HasEvents() for a range of events
* Added SDL_GetEventState() as a shortcut for SDL_EventState(X, SDL_QUERY)
* Added SDL_FlushEvent() and SDL_FlushEvents() to clear events from the event queue

Sam Lantinga
102fd54847 Fixed bug #935
Patrice Mandin

Hello,

I originally added pth support for threads in SDL 1.2 because on the Atari
platform we did not have any thread library.

I think pth support could be removed from SDL 1.3 for two reasons:

- Atari platform removed

- pth does not provides real (preemptive) threads, because it is user space,
and expect the application to call one of its function to give CPU to another
thread. So it is not exactly useful for applications, that expect threads to
run simultaneously.
